def _backup_file(file_path: Path) -> Path | None:
"""Create a timestamped backup of a file if it exists and content differs.
Backups are stored in XDG config dir under compose-farm/backups/.
The original file's absolute path is mirrored in the backup directory.
Returns the backup path if created, None if no backup was needed.
"""
if not file_path.exists():
return None
# Create backup directory mirroring original path structure
# e.g., /opt/stacks/plex/compose.yaml -> ~/.config/compose-farm/backups/opt/stacks/plex/
# On Windows: C:\Users\foo\stacks -> backups/Users/foo/stacks
resolved = file_path.resolve()
file_backup_dir = backup_dir() / resolved.parent.relative_to(resolved.anchor)
file_backup_dir.mkdir(parents=True, exist_ok=True)
# Generate timestamped backup filename
timestamp = datetime.now(tz=UTC).strftime("%Y%m%d_%H%M%S")
backup_name = f"{file_path.name}.{timestamp}"
backup_path = file_backup_dir / backup_name
# Copy current content to backup
backup_path.write_text(file_path.read_text())
# Clean up old backups (keep last 200)
backups = sorted(file_backup_dir.glob(f"{file_path.name}.*"), reverse=True)
for old_backup in backups[200:]:
old_backup.unlink()
return backup_path
def _save_with_backup(file_path: Path, content: str) -> bool:
"""Save content to file, creating a backup first if content changed.
Returns True if file was saved, False if content was unchanged.
"""
# Check if content actually changed
if file_path.exists():
current_content = file_path.read_text()
if current_content == content:
return False # No change, skip save
_backup_file(file_path)
file_path.write_text(content)
return True

async def _get_container_states(
config: Any, stack: str, containers: list[dict[str, Any]]
) -> list[dict[str, Any]]:
"""Query Docker for actual container states on a single host."""
if not containers:
return containers
# All containers should be on the same host
host_name = containers[0]["Host"]
# Use -a to include stopped/exited containers
result = await run_compose_on_host(
config, stack, host_name, "ps -a --format json", stream=False
)
if not result.success:
logger.warning(
"Failed to get container states for %s on %s: %s",
stack,
host_name,
result.stderr or result.stdout,
)
return containers
# Build state map: name -> (state, exit_code)
state_map: dict[str, tuple[str, int]] = {}
for line in result.stdout.strip().split("\n"):
if line.strip():
with contextlib.suppress(json.JSONDecodeError):
data = json.loads(line)
name = data.get("Name", "")
state = data.get("State", "unknown")
exit_code = data.get("ExitCode", 0)
state_map[name] = (state, exit_code)
# Update container states
for c in containers:
if c["Name"] in state_map:
state, exit_code = state_map[c["Name"]]
c["State"] = state
c["ExitCode"] = exit_code
else:
# Container not in ps output means it was never started
c["State"] = "created"
c["ExitCode"] = None
return containers

async def _read_file_remote(host: Any, path: str) -> str:
"""Read a file from a remote host via SSH."""
# Expand ~ on remote by using shell
cmd = f"cat {shlex.quote(path)}"
if path.startswith("~/"):
cmd = f"cat ~/{shlex.quote(path[2:])}"
async with asyncssh.connect(**ssh_connect_kwargs(host)) as conn:
result = await conn.run(cmd, check=True)
stdout = result.stdout or ""
return stdout.decode() if isinstance(stdout, bytes) else stdout
async def _write_file_remote(host: Any, path: str, content: str) -> None:
"""Write content to a file on a remote host via SSH."""
# Expand ~ on remote: keep ~ unquoted for shell expansion, quote the rest
target = f"~/{shlex.quote(path[2:])}" if path.startswith("~/") else shlex.quote(path)
cmd = f"cat > {target}"
async with asyncssh.connect(**ssh_connect_kwargs(host)) as conn:
result = await conn.run(cmd, input=content, check=True)
if result.returncode != 0:
stderr = result.stderr.decode() if isinstance(result.stderr, bytes) else result.stderr
msg = f"Failed to write file: {stderr}"
raise RuntimeError(msg)
